CVE-2014-4875: CreateBossCredentials.jar in Toshiba CHEC before 6.6 build 4014 and 6.7 before build 4329 contains a hardco...

CreateBossCredentials.jar in Toshiba CHEC before 6.6 build 4014 and 6.7 before build 4329 contains a hardcoded AES key, which allows attackers to discover Back Office System Server (BOSS) DB2 database credentials by leveraging knowledge of this key in conjunction with bossinfo.pro read access.

Toshiba CHEC stored an encryption key inside CreateBossCredentials.jar. If an attacker can read the bossinfo.pro file and knows this key, they may recover BOSS DB2 database credentials. The business risk is credential exposure for back-office database access, but the public bundle does not provide CVSS, CWE, or confirmed exploitation. Exposure is likely limited to organizations running the affected Toshiba CHEC builds with accessible bossinfo.pro files. Internet exposure is not established by the provided sources. The main exposure path is local, server-side, or account-based file read access combined with the hardcoded key knowledge. Prioritize remediation if Toshiba CHEC supports payment, retail, or back-office operations where BOSS DB2 credentials are sensitive. The issue is old, but credential exposure can persist if affected builds or reused database passwords remain in service. Mitigation focus: Identify Toshiba CHEC versions before 6.6 build 4014 or 6.7 build 4329.; Check CERT and vendor guidance for supported fixed builds and upgrade paths.; Restrict filesystem access to bossinfo.pro and related CHEC configuration files..
